When it comes to education, Thailand offers numerous options suitable for every parent’s needs. Among these options, international schools are known for their high-quality education and holistic learner experience, though they come with higher tuition fees. While the costs might seem significant, they are often justifiable for expatriates due to the comprehensive educational offerings and global curriculum standards.
While Bangkok is often the focal point for expatriates seeking quality schooling for their children, several outstanding international schools are located throughout the country. These institutions offer diverse curricula (British and American systems to the International Baccalaureate (IB)), modern facilities, and a multicultural environment that caters to the educational needs of expatriate families.
This listicle highlights the top international schools in Thailand outside of Bangkok, providing insights for families considering relocation.

1. British International School, Phuket (BISP)

Located on a sprawling 44-acre campus, BISP is one of Thailand’s largest and most prestigious international schools. The school offers a holistic education from preschool through Year 13, following the English National Curriculum alongside the International Baccalaureate (IB) Diploma Programme. BISP is known for its exceptional facilities, including sports complexes, science labs, and arts centres, fostering a well-rounded educational experience.
2. UWC Thailand International School

Situated in Phuket near beautiful national parks, UWC Thailand emphasises academic excellence and personal development through mindfulness and social-emotional learning. The school offers the IB curriculum from primary through high school and features modern facilities such as a performing arts centre and sports hall. UWC’s focus on global citizenship prepares students to make a positive impact in their communities.
3. Regents International School Pattaya

Regents International School Pattaya offers a British curriculum alongside IGCSE and IB Diploma options. The school is known for its innovative STEAM (Science, Technology, Engineering, Arts, Mathematics) programmes, which were developed in collaboration with MIT. These programmes emphasise creativity and critical thinking. Its state-of-the-art facilities include music studios and art rooms, which support a vibrant extracurricular environment.
4. Lanna International School, Chiang Mai

Lanna International School, located in Chiang Mai, offers an English-language education based on the Cambridge curriculum for students aged 2 to 18. This school focuses on developing well-rounded individuals through character-building initiatives and a wide range of extracurricular activities. Lanna has consistently high academic results in IGCSEs and A Levels.
5. St. Andrews International School Green Valley

Located in Rayong, near Pattaya, St. Andrews combines the British National Curriculum with the IB program. The school provides a nurturing environment for students aged 2 to 18 and emphasises inquiry-based learning and personal development. Its lush green campus supports various extracurricular activities and fosters a strong sense of community among students.
6. PBISS British International School of Samui

PBISS, the British International School of Samui, offers a unique educational experience on the island of Koh Samui. Following the British National Curriculum from nursery through Year 11, the school focuses on personalised learning in small class sizes. With an emphasis on outdoor learning and community involvement, students benefit from an engaging and supportive environment.
7. International School of Chonburi (ISC)

Located in Chonburi province, ISC offers an American-style education from preschool through high school, with Advanced Placement (AP) courses available for older students. The school’s commitment to fostering global citizenship is reflected in its diverse student body and extensive extracurricular programs that encourage personal growth and leadership skills.
8. Krabi International School

Krabi International School provides an affordable yet high-quality education for students aged 5 to 18, following the Cambridge curriculum. Known for its small class sizes and personalised instruction, the school emphasises community involvement and character development alongside academic achievement in IGCSEs and A Levels.
9. HeadStart International School, Phuket

Established in 2005, HeadStart International School has rapidly developed into one of Phuket’s leading international schools. The school offers the English National Curriculum for students aged 2 to 18 and currently enrols over 1,300 students across two campuses, representing more than 50 different nationalities. HeadStart is committed to providing a quality teaching and learning environment for Phuket’s international and culturally diverse community.
10. Hua Hin International School

Hua Hin International School provides an international education based on the British curriculum for students aged 3 to 18. Focusing on small class sizes and individualised attention, this school fosters a nurturing environment where students can thrive academically while engaging in various extracurricular activities.
